Transaction cb02663e018db1e5d4fa6b64a69ee3c0a20e30d1c6bcaf6a8151f7fa19a153e1

block
2386a8a15c07c704218621d934d20efb00a10b41daee1367b71e67ce54a03391

1 Input

24 Outputs